Medical Scientists conduct research aimed at improving overall human health. They often use clinical trials and other investigative methods to reach their findings.
What do they typically do
- Design and conduct studies to investigate human diseases and methods to prevent and treat diseases
- Prepare and analyze data from medical samples and investigate causes and treatment of toxicity, pathogens, or chronic diseases
- Standardize drugs' potency, doses, and methods of administering to allow for their mass manufacturing and distribution
- Create and test medical devices
- Follow safety procedures, such as decontaminating workspaces
- Write research grant proposals and apply for funding from government agencies, private funding, and other sources
- Write articles for publication and present research findings
